Vasopressin is a man-made form of a hormone called "anti-diuretic hormone". Vasopressin helps prevent loss of water from the body by reducing urine output and helping the kidneys reabsorb water into the body. Explain their significance in DI treatment. Diabetic ketoacidosis (DKA) is an acute, life-threatening condition characterized by hyperglycemia (greater than 300 mg/dL) resulting in the breakdown of body fat for energy and an accumulation of ketones in the blood and urine. Lowers blood glucose by: stimulating glucose uptake in skeletal muscle and fat, inhibiting hepatic glucose production. Other actions of insulin: inhibition of lipolysis and proteolysis, enhanced protein synthesis.
